CSU Fringe Benefit Rate

Shown below are the fringe benefit calculations for grant related employment:

1.Full Time Regular Employment - Faculty / Administrator / Civil Service - 100% Employment to the Grant - Employment Start Date After April 1, 1986.
Retirement - 11.00% of Gross Wages from Grant
Insurance - $400 - $600 per month depending on benefit package
Social Security - 1.45% of Gross Wages from Grant

2.Full Time Regular Employment - Faculty / Administrator / Civil Service - 100% Employment to the Grant - Employment Start Date After April 1, 1996.
Retirement - 11.00% of Gross Wages from Grant
Insurance - $400 - $600 per month depending on benefit package

3. Full Time Regular Employment - Faculty / Administrator / Civil Service - 50% Employment to the Grant.
Retirement - 11.00% of Gross Wages from Grant
Insurance - $400 - $600/Mo. X 50% depending on benefit package
Social Security - 1.45% of Gross Wages from Grant if Start Date after 4/1/86

4.Overrides - Salary in Addition to Regular Full Time Effort.
The Personnel Form Should Specifically State That Wages to the Grant are an Override.
Retirement - 11.00% of Gross Wages from Grant
Social Security - 1.45% of Gross Wages from Grant

5.Part Time Staff/Extra Help - Less Than Four Months Employment
Social Security - 7.65% of Gross Wages from Grant

6. Part Time Staff/Extra Help - More Than Four Months Employment
Retirement - 11.00% Gross Wages from Grant
Social Security - 1.45% of Gross Wages from Grant

7.Graduate Student Assistants
Social Security - 7.65% of Gross Wages from Grant8. Undergrad Students/Foreign
No Fringe Benefits

CSU Indirect Cost Rate

Colleges And Universities Rate Agreement

The rates approved in this agreement are for use on grants, contracts and other agreements with the federal government subject to the conditions in section III.

Section I: FACILITIES AND ADMINISTRATIVE COST RATES*

Rate Types: FIXED   FINAL   PROV.(PROVISIONAL)   PRED.(PREDETERMINED)  
  EFFECTIVE PERIOD      
TYPE FROM TO RATE% LOCATIONS APPLICABLE TO
PRED. 07/01/01 06/30/04 49.0 On Campus Organized Research
PRED. 07/01/01 06/30/04 26.0 Off Campus Organized Research
PROV. 07/01/04 UNTIL AMENDED   Use same rates and conditions as those cited for fiscal year ending June 30, 2004.

BASE:

Modified total direct costs, consisting of all salaries and wages, fringe benefits, materials, supplies, services, travel and subgrants and subcontracts up to the first $25,000 of each subgrant or subcontract (regardless of the period covered by the subgrant or subcontract). Modified total direct costs shall exclude equipment, capital expenditures, charges for patient care, tuition remission, rental costs of of-site facilities, scholarships, and fellowship as well as the portion of each subgrant and subcontract in excess of $25,000.
